Latest Patents

Suessmann's latest patents include a method for producing a heat exchanger and a design for a plate heat exchanger. The method for producing a heat exchanger involves creating a plate heat exchanger from multiple heat exchanger blocks. Each block is equipped with a header that extends over part of its side, allowing for a flow connection between adjacent blocks. The design of the plate heat exchanger features a heat exchanger block with numerous heat exchange passages, where the header facilitates fluid connections in a perpendicular arrangement.
